creating shortcuts and dealing with PHP includes


Alright.. I've searched plenty, but can't find a solution. So now I Come to the faithful Linux community to help me

I'm running my server, using MoveableType (Blog Publishing System) to manage my Website.

I have multiple folders for content and such, but only my main directory has the includes that contain the static content for my site.

My problem lies in such that I need to create a shortcut for Directory B ("Archives") which links to Directory A ("Webroot").
Why? Because the output from MoveableType isn't static, it creates files in my Archives directory and is constantly being updated if I make changes or people comment, etc.

So is there a way to create (Web shortcuts?) from one folder to another?

eg.
I have my include.php in my webroot directory, but it's also needed in my archives directory to keep content the same..

I hope someone understand this, or uses MoveableType and can help me out?

Nevermind. I figured it out. using the 'Link' command in Konsole.
When File A is updated.. the linked File B is updated as well.
